Signed-off-by: Andi Kleen --- tools/perf/Documentation/perf-list.txt | 42 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 1 file changed, 42 insertions(+) diff --git a/tools/perf/Documentation/perf-list.txt b/tools/perf/Documentation/perf-list.txt index 41857cce5e86..511adc684148 100644 --- a/tools/perf/Documentation/perf-list.txt +++ b/tools/perf/Documentation/perf-list.txt @@ -119,6 +119,48 @@ be specified as perf stat -e cpu/event=0xa8,umask=0x1,name=LSD.UOPS_CYCLES,cmask=1/ ... +EVENT PARAMETERS +---------------- + +The pmu// syntax in perf uses parameters to configure the event for the +PMU. + +For a list of available parameters for each PMU please use + + ls /sys/devices/*/format + +Common parameters are + +. event=NUM: Event code +. umask=NUM: Event umask + +In addition perf supports some extra parameters to further configure then +event + +. name=name: Use name to display the event in perf +. period=NUM: Use sampling period NUM for the event. Similar to the -c parameter, +but only applies to this event. Only valid for perf record and top. +. freq=NUM: Use sampling frequency NUM for the event. Similar to the -c parameter, +but only applies to this event. Only valid for perf record and top. +. branch_type=TYPE: Enable last branch sampling for event. TYPE is the same +as the argument to perf record's -j option. Use any to be equivalent to -b. +when no is specified branch sampling is disabled for this event. Only valid +for perf record and top. +. time=NUM: When NUM is non zero collect a time stamp for the event. +. call-graph=type: Enable call graph mode for the event. When no is specified call +graph is disabled. The parameters are the as to the --call-graph option of +perf record. Only valid for perf record and top. +. stack-size=BYTES: For dwarf unwinding call graph mode limit the number of stack +bytes collected to BYTES. +. max-stack=NUM: For call graph mode limit the number of entries to NUM. +. inherit: Inherit the event to child processes. +. no-inherit: Do not inherit the event to child processes. +. overwrite: Enable overwrite mode in the perf buffer. +. no-overwrite: Do not enable overwrite mode in the perf buffer. +. config=NUM: Configure config parameter in perf event attribute. +. config1=NUM: Configure config1 parameter in perf event attribute. +. config2=NUM: Configure config2 parameter in perf event attribute. + PER SOCKET PMUS --------------- -- 2.5.5
